Joanie Pallatto

Born:

Described by Rick Kogan of the Chicago Tribune as having "a stirring and special voice," Singer-Songwriter Joanie Pallatto has a history of 43 years as one of Chicago's leading studio voices, an independent artist with 17 albums as a leader/co-leader, and Southport Records co-chair responsible for 100's of recordings of otherwise little-documented local musical artists (Willie Pickens, Von Freeman, George Freeman, King Fleming, Bobby Lewis, Fred Anderson...)

Joanie Pallatto is a graduate of The University of Cincinnati College-Conservatory of Music (CCM.) Pallatto toured with The Glenn Miller Orchestra as a featured vocalist before moving to Chicago in 1979. Co-owner and partner with pianist/composer and husband, Bradley Parker-Sparrow at Sparrow Sound Design Recording Studio and Southport Records, Pallatto has expertise in all aspects of musical production. As a studio singer and voiceover talent, she has recorded on hundreds of Radio and TV commercials, including McDonald's, United Airlines and Hamburger Helper. As a jazz vocalist, Pallatto has performed at Chicago clubs, including City Winery, The Green Mill, Venus Cabaret Theater, Andy's and New York venues Iridium Jazz Club, Pangea and Birdland. Concert engagements have included Chicago Jazz Festival, Chicago Cultural Center, The Old Town School of Folk Music, Park West, Stage 773 and Bailiwick Theater; she was also a featured soloist with Daniel Barenboim in "Ellington Among Friends" at Symphony Center in 1999.
